HURRY, HELP ME PLEASE In this lab, you complete a partially written C++ program that includes two functions that require a single parameter.
The program continuously prompts the user for an integer until the user enters 0. The program then passes the value to a function that computes the sum of all the whole numbers from 1 up to and including the entered number. Next, the program passes the value to another function that computes the product of all the whole numbers up to and including the entered number.

The given code is:
// SumAndProduct. cpp - This program computes sums and products
// Input: Interactive
// Output: Computed sum and product

#include
#include
void sums(int);
void products(int);
using namespace std;

int main()
{
double number;

cout << "Enter a positive integer or 0 to quit: ";
cin >> number;

while(number != 0)
{
// Call sums function here

// Call products function here

cout << "Enter a positive integer or 0 to quit: ";
cin >> number;
}
return 0;
} // End of main function

// Write sums function here

// Write products function here

Write a program that prints the day number of the year, given the date in the form month-day-year. for example, if the input is 1-1-2006, the day number is 1; if the input is 12-25-2006, the day number is 359. the program should check for a leap year. a year is a leap year if it is divisible by 4, but not divisible by 100. for example, 1992 and 2008 are divisible by 4, but not by 100. a year that is divisible by 100 is a leap year if it is also divisible by 400. for example, 1600 and 2000 are divisible by 400. however, 1800 is not a leap year because 1800 is not divisible by 400.
